Trailing Lines Indoors

Visible ant trails from entry points to food sources along baseboards or counters

Sawdust-Like Frass

Small piles of debris near wood suggesting carpenter ant tunneling activity

Nest Mounds Outside

Soil mounds near the foundation or pavement cracks that serve as colony entrances

An ant service starts with a careful look at trails, entry points, and nesting sites around the home. The technician checks cracks in the foundation, plumbing lines, windows, and damp areas outside where ants may be feeding or nesting. Treatment often uses bait, targeted spray, and outside barrier work, since the best approach depends on the ant species and where the colony sits. In Newport, the inspection also focuses on moisture problems that help ants stay active after rain.

After treatment, ant traffic should drop as workers carry bait back to the colony or lose access to the routes they used before. Some nests take more time to control, especially when they sit under soil, mulch, or damp wood. Follow-up service can help if new trails appear during another wet spell. Ant Treatment Options in Newport

Interior Ant Treatment

Gel bait and residual spray applied to trailing routes, entry gaps, and nesting sites inside the structure.

Learn More →

Exterior Barrier Application

Liquid barrier applied around the foundation, mulch beds, and entry points to stop colonies at the perimeter.

Learn More →

Fire Ant Yard Treatment

Granular or liquid broadcast treatment targeting fire ant mounds in lawns, flower beds, and landscape areas.

Learn More →

Carpenter Ant Elimination

Targeted treatment for carpenter ants nesting in wood members, window frames, and moisture-damaged areas.

Ant activity often drops within days, but full control can take longer if the colony is large or has more than one nest. Bait works by getting the ants to carry the product back to the colony, which takes time and patience. Newport's wet weather can also create new trails after rain, so follow-up may be needed if activity shifts. The goal is steady control and a home that feels ant-free again.

You can sometimes stop a small trail with store products, but that usually does not fix a nest hidden in the wall or outside soil. Sprays can scatter some ant species and make the problem harder to track. In Newport, damp crawlspaces and rainy weather can keep new ants moving in even after a quick DIY attempt. A pro can find the source and treat it more fully.
